Hi! I've made a custom section head family for a project, but I have an issue with text placement.

 

Feilsøking.jpg

As you can see, my labels don't rotate with my sections! The south-facing section is showing the box I made for the text, but the text itself is hovering over the other north-facing section... This is my first time trying this, so there might be some tips and tricks I don't know about? How can I solve this problem?

Did you start this family from a Section Head Template?  It's missing the intelligent  "Rotate with Section" Line.
